У меня есть QComboBox с 4 вариантами. Я хотел бы выбрать опцию, и соответствующие данные из Sqlite3 отображаются в QTableWidget. Никакая документация онлайн не помогла. Кто-нибудь, помогите, пожалуйста.
def fetch_learner_data_from_combo(self):
connection= sqlite3.connect("mydb.db")
query = "SELECT * FROM learner_data WHERE STREAM="+str(self.stream_combo.currentText())
result = connection.execute(query)
self.marks_table.setRowCount(0)
for row_number,row_data in enumerate(result):
self.marks_table.insertRow(row_number)
for column_number,data in enumerate(row_data):
self.marks_table.setItem(row_number,column_number,QTableWidgetItem(str(data)))
connection.commit()
connection.close()